Well, seems the parser is raising the wrong message here... need to fix that...
   But the syntax should be something like:

rule "calculate average"
        when
                $media : Number( doubleValue > 50000)
                            from accumulate( Instance( $value : classValue ),
                                          average($value))
        then
                System.out.println(media );
end

I'm integrating Weka with Drools v.4 and I have a parsing error while trying
to read the following DRL rule:

rule "calculate average"
        when
                $inst : Instance()
                $media : Double(double value > 50000)
                            from accumulate($value : inst.classValue()
                                          average($value))
        then
                 System.out.println(media );
end

I have the following error:

org.drools.compiler.DroolsParserException: Unknown error while parsing. This
is a bug. Please contact the Development team.
        at org.drools.compiler.DrlParser.compile (DrlParser.java:180)
        at org.drools.compiler.DrlParser.parse(DrlParser.java:61)
        at
org.drools.compiler.PackageBuilder.addPackageFromDrl(PackageBuilder.java:158)
        at com.sample.DroolsTest.readRule (DroolsTest.java:67)
        at com.sample.DroolsTest.main(DroolsTest.java:24)

What I am doing wrong?
